For the incoming director: this summary covers the pricing review of the Verdella product line completed last month. Margins have eroded from 34% to 27% over four quarters, driven by input costs and discounting at the Thornbay distributor tier. The review recommends a 6% list increase, tiered discount caps, and retirement of two low-volume variants. Modelled revenue impact is neutral in year one, positive thereafter. Full workings are attached. The confidential strategic note follows immediately below.

management briefing: Project Ulavan slips by two quarters because of the staffing delay.

Adds a plugin system for data validators in Quillbase. Validators register via entry points; the loader sandboxes each plugin with a per-call timeout and memory cap so one bad validator can't stall ingestion. Failures downgrade to warnings unless marked strict. Maintainers: tune limits centrally, never per-plugin. The defaults shipping with this PR are listed here.

tuning table, kajog-kawef:
PRIORITIES = {
    "kelox": 870,
    "kasix": 89,
    "eliax": 988,
}

MEMO — Finance Team

Re: Churn in the Hollowick pilot programme.

Of 42 pilot accounts on the Stratus Ledger product, 9 have lapsed since June — double our modelled rate. Exit interviews cite onboarding friction, not price. Renewal revenue at risk: roughly 6% of the pilot book. Danvers proposes a retention credit; finance must cost it by Friday. Context on the wider plan is appended below.

confidential, kagep-kahof: Druokax Systems plans to lower the Ulaath list price by 53 percent in March.

Subject: Log sampling live on Chirple

Hey support folks — quick heads-up that the cut-over landed last night. Chirple (yes, the chattiest service in the fleet) now samples its info-level logs instead of writing every single line. Errors and warnings are still captured at 100%, so nothing you rely on for tickets is lost. Searches should feel faster and storage bills smaller. If a trace looks thin, that's the sampling at work. The new settings are below.

deployment values, yafop-tahof:
HOLIX_HOST=holix.zemvarsys.internal
HOLIX_PORT=3306